Understanding Tropical Weather Patterns
Alright, guys, let’s get down to the nitty-gritty of tropical weather patterns in the Gulf of Mexico. This region is a playground for weather systems, driven by a combination of factors that create a unique and often intense climate. We'll unpack the key elements that influence the weather, giving you a solid understanding of what makes the Gulf tick. The Gulf’s warm waters are the engine that drives its tropical weather. These warm waters provide the energy needed for tropical storms to form and intensify. When warm, moist air rises from the ocean's surface, it creates an area of low pressure. As more air rushes in to fill this space, it also warms and rises, creating a cycle. This process forms thunderstorms that can develop into a tropical depression, then a tropical storm, and finally, a hurricane. The intensity of these systems is closely linked to the sea surface temperature; the warmer the water, the more powerful the storms. Another key player is the Intertropical Convergence Zone (ITCZ). This is a band of low pressure that circles the Earth near the equator. The ITCZ is a region where the trade winds from the Northern and Southern Hemispheres meet, creating rising air and a lot of thunderstorms. Sometimes, disturbances in the ITCZ can move into the Gulf, adding fuel to the fire and potentially sparking tropical systems. The position of the Bermuda High, a semi-permanent high-pressure system, also affects the Gulf’s weather. This high-pressure system can steer hurricanes and influence wind patterns across the region. When the Bermuda High is strong, it can guide storms away from the Gulf, but a weaker high-pressure system can allow storms to enter the area. Understanding these elements is essential for predicting and understanding the weather in the Gulf of Mexico.
The Role of Sea Surface Temperatures
Let’s zoom in on a critical factor: sea surface temperatures (SSTs). In the Gulf of Mexico, these temperatures are more than just a number; they are the fuel for hurricanes and tropical storms. The warm waters store an immense amount of energy, which is then released into the atmosphere, influencing weather patterns. High SSTs are the reason the Gulf is a prime location for these intense weather events. When the water is warm, the air above it becomes warm and moist. This warm, moist air rises, creating areas of low pressure. As more air rushes in to fill this space, it also warms and rises, continuing the cycle. This process fuels the development of thunderstorms. If enough thunderstorms form and persist, they can organize into a tropical depression, then a tropical storm, and potentially a hurricane. During the hurricane season, from June 1st to November 30th, the Gulf's SSTs are usually at their highest. These warmer temperatures increase the likelihood of stronger and more frequent storms. The warmer the water, the more energy is available for a storm to intensify. The higher the SST, the more moisture is available, further energizing the storm. The difference in temperature between the sea surface and the upper atmosphere is also essential. This difference creates instability, which is what allows the air to rise and thunderstorms to develop. A strong temperature gradient makes it easier for storms to form and strengthen. Tracking SSTs is a major part of weather forecasting. Meteorologists use satellite data, buoys, and other tools to monitor SSTs. This information helps them understand the potential for storm development and to predict their intensity. The ability to forecast storms improves. So, next time you hear about SSTs, remember that they are the engine driving the storms in the Gulf of Mexico.
Intertropical Convergence Zone (ITCZ) and its Influence
Now, let's talk about the Intertropical Convergence Zone (ITCZ), a major influence on the weather in the Gulf. The ITCZ is a broad band of low pressure that encircles the Earth near the equator. It’s where the trade winds from the Northern and Southern Hemispheres converge. This convergence creates a region of rising air, cloud formation, and heavy rainfall. While the ITCZ is usually located near the equator, its position can shift seasonally. In the Northern Hemisphere's summer, the ITCZ typically moves northward. This movement can bring increased rainfall and cloud cover to the Gulf region. The ITCZ plays a significant role in the Gulf of Mexico’s weather, particularly during the hurricane season. Disturbances that develop within the ITCZ can sometimes move northward, entering the Gulf and potentially developing into tropical storms or hurricanes. These disturbances can be a source of energy and moisture for these developing systems. The location and activity of the ITCZ can affect the overall weather patterns in the Gulf. When the ITCZ is active, the Gulf may experience increased cloudiness and rainfall. The activity of the ITCZ is affected by various factors, including sea surface temperatures, atmospheric pressure, and the movement of air masses. Meteorologists monitor the ITCZ closely. They use satellite data, weather models, and surface observations to track its position and activity. This helps them understand the potential for storm development and predict weather patterns. Changes in the ITCZ’s activity can significantly alter the frequency and intensity of storms in the Gulf. This makes it an essential component of understanding tropical weather dynamics.
Hurricanes and Tropical Storms: What You Need to Know
Alright, folks, let's get into the main event: Hurricanes and Tropical Storms! These powerful weather systems are a defining feature of the Gulf of Mexico's climate. Knowing how they form, their impact, and how to stay safe is super important for anyone living near the Gulf. Tropical storms and hurricanes are born from the warm waters of the Gulf. As we talked about before, the warm sea surface temperatures fuel these storms, providing the energy they need to grow. The storms start as tropical disturbances, clusters of thunderstorms that begin to organize. If these disturbances persist and develop, they can become a tropical depression, with sustained winds of less than 39 mph. If the winds increase to 39 mph or more, the depression becomes a tropical storm, and gets a name. And finally, if the winds reach 74 mph or higher, the storm becomes a hurricane. Hurricanes are classified using the Saffir-Simpson Hurricane Wind Scale. This scale categorizes hurricanes based on their wind speed, from Category 1 (74-95 mph) to Category 5 (157 mph or higher). The higher the category, the more destructive the storm. Hurricanes bring a range of hazards, including high winds, heavy rainfall, storm surge, and tornadoes. High winds can cause extensive damage to structures and infrastructure. Heavy rainfall can lead to flooding. Storm surge, the rise in sea level caused by the storm's winds, is often the most deadly aspect. Tornadoes can also spin off from the outer bands of the hurricane. The impact of these storms is extensive, affecting everything from property and infrastructure to the environment and the economy. They can cause widespread power outages, disrupt transportation, and displace communities. That’s why preparing for these storms is super important. That means having a hurricane plan, building a disaster kit, and staying informed about the latest weather updates. During a hurricane, it’s crucial to follow the instructions of local authorities and take necessary precautions to ensure your safety. Let’s look at the key elements of these storms.
Formation and Development
Let’s dive into the formation and development of these powerful weather events. Hurricanes start with a tropical disturbance, a disorganized area of thunderstorms over warm ocean waters. For this disturbance to grow into a hurricane, several conditions must be in place. First, there needs to be a source of warm, moist air, like the Gulf of Mexico. This warm water is the fuel for the storm, providing the energy it needs to grow. Second, there must be a pre-existing area of low pressure. As the warm, moist air rises from the ocean's surface, it creates an area of low pressure. This area is where the storm begins to take shape. Third, the Coriolis effect, caused by the Earth’s rotation, is necessary for the storm to spin. This effect causes the air and water to curve as they move, creating the swirling motion characteristic of hurricanes. The formation of a hurricane goes through several stages. It starts as a tropical disturbance, then progresses to a tropical depression. If the conditions are favorable, and the winds reach 39 mph or more, the depression becomes a tropical storm, and gets a name. The storm will continue to intensify if conditions permit. Once the winds reach 74 mph or more, the storm becomes a hurricane. The storm’s development is influenced by a number of factors. Sea surface temperatures, as we talked about, are critical. Upper-level winds also play a role; strong vertical wind shear can disrupt the storm and prevent it from strengthening. The storm's path can also influence its intensity. A storm moving over cooler waters or encountering land will usually weaken. The entire process, from a tropical disturbance to a hurricane, can take several days or even weeks, depending on the conditions. Understanding how hurricanes form and develop is key for meteorologists, helping them to predict a storm’s path and intensity. This is essential for issuing warnings and ensuring that people can prepare and stay safe. The knowledge helps people understand the risks and take necessary precautions.
Impact and Hazards
Now, let's explore the impact and hazards associated with these intense storms. Hurricanes bring a range of dangers that can affect everything from your home to the environment. The primary hazards associated with hurricanes include high winds, heavy rainfall, storm surge, and tornadoes. High winds can cause extensive damage. They can topple trees, damage buildings, and disrupt power and communication lines. Heavy rainfall can lead to flooding, both from overflowing rivers and from the accumulation of water on the ground. Storm surge is often the most dangerous aspect of a hurricane. It is the rise in sea level caused by the storm's winds, and can inundate coastal areas, causing devastating flooding. Tornadoes are another hazard, often spinning off from the outer bands of a hurricane. They can add to the destructive potential of the storm. The impact of hurricanes goes beyond the immediate hazards. They can cause widespread power outages, disrupting essential services and impacting everyday life. Flooding can damage homes and businesses, leading to costly repairs. Hurricanes can also impact the environment, causing erosion, damaging ecosystems, and polluting water sources. The economic impact is also significant. Storms can disrupt transportation, damage infrastructure, and affect tourism and other industries. The aftermath of a hurricane can be extensive. This requires community efforts for cleaning up, restoring essential services, and rebuilding. Preparing for these storms is essential to mitigate the impact. This involves creating a hurricane plan, building a disaster kit, and staying informed about the latest weather updates and warnings. Knowing the hazards and how to respond is key to staying safe during a hurricane. Being aware of the risks and preparing accordingly can help protect both your property and your life.

Reliable Sources for Weather Updates
Finding reliable sources is key to staying ahead of the game with the weather. With so many sources available, it's essential to know where to find accurate and timely information. The National Hurricane Center (NHC) is the primary source. The NHC is part of the National Weather Service and is responsible for monitoring and forecasting tropical cyclones. Their website provides the latest hurricane forecasts, advisories, and warnings. The information on the NHC website is updated frequently, often multiple times a day during a storm. Local news channels and weather apps also provide valuable information. Most local TV stations have a meteorologist on staff who provides detailed weather reports and updates. These reports often include information specific to your local area. Many weather apps are also available, providing real-time weather data, including radar images, satellite views, and alerts. When using weather apps, be sure to choose reputable sources. Government agencies and weather organizations usually provide the most reliable information. Also, social media can be a source of information. However, be cautious when using social media. Verify information with trusted sources before acting on it. Understanding different types of weather alerts is also important. These alerts provide information about the severity of a weather event and the actions you should take. Watches mean that a hazardous weather event is possible. Warnings mean that a hazardous weather event is imminent or already occurring. Stay informed by checking these sources regularly, especially during the hurricane season. Reliable information is the most important tool.
Creating a Hurricane Preparedness Plan
Let’s get into creating a hurricane preparedness plan - it's crucial for your safety and peace of mind during hurricane season. This plan is your roadmap for action. It will guide you through all the necessary steps to protect yourself, your family, and your home. The first step is to assess your risk. Determine your home's vulnerability to flooding, storm surge, and high winds. Know your evacuation zone and where the nearest shelters are located. Once you have assessed your risks, you should develop an evacuation plan. Decide where you will go if you need to evacuate. This might be a relative's home, a hotel, or a public shelter. Plan your route, and know which evacuation routes are available in your area. Practice your evacuation plan. Your plan should also cover how you will communicate with your family and friends during the storm. Identify a contact person who lives outside the affected area and will be your point of contact. Make sure all family members know this person's contact information. Make a disaster kit that contains essential supplies. This kit should include water, non-perishable food, a first-aid kit, medications, flashlights, batteries, and a battery-powered or hand-crank radio. Secure your home, by reinforcing your windows and doors and trimming any trees and bushes that could be a hazard. Protect important documents. Make sure to have copies of essential documents, like insurance policies, medical records, and identification. Have these documents in a waterproof container, or store them digitally. Review your plan and update it annually. Hurricane season is long, and your plan should reflect any changes. Preparing for a hurricane can feel daunting, but it can also provide a sense of security. You’ll be ready for any weather that comes your way.
Building a Disaster Kit
Now, let’s talk about building a disaster kit – it’s a crucial step in preparing for a hurricane and ensuring your survival. Your kit should include all the essential supplies you might need in the event of a storm. A well-stocked disaster kit will make a huge difference in your comfort and safety. First, include enough water for each person in your household for at least three days. The general recommendation is one gallon per person per day. Include non-perishable food. This could be canned goods, energy bars, dried fruit, and other items that don't need refrigeration and can last for several days. Include a first-aid kit. This should contain bandages, antiseptic wipes, pain relievers, and any personal medications. Include a flashlight with extra batteries, along with a battery-powered or hand-crank radio. These will be essential for getting weather updates when the power is out. Include personal hygiene items. This includes items such as soap, toothpaste, toilet paper, and feminine hygiene products. Include a whistle to signal for help. Include any necessary tools, such as a can opener, a multi-tool, and duct tape. Have copies of important documents. This could include insurance policies, medical records, and identification. Put these documents in a waterproof bag. It is also good to have cash on hand. ATMs may not work during a storm. Customize your kit to suit your needs. If you have pets, make sure to include pet food and other supplies. If you have infants, include diapers, formula, and baby wipes. Keep your kit in a convenient location, so it's easy to grab in case of an evacuation. Check and update your kit regularly, especially after a storm. It’s always best to be prepared.
